2010-01-11 79 views
2

嗨,我在c#winform中有一个组合框。 我必须针对每个元素保存两件东西。将显示给用户的文本和针对该文本的ID。在Combobox中保存数值和文本

在Asp.Net,我们可以在列表框中的文本和值字段保存这些值..

,但如何处理winform应用程序

回答

3

您可以使用BindingSource来存储数据。然后将其绑定到您的ComboBox。请记住设置ComboBox.ValueMember(指向ID字段)和ComboBox.DisplayMember(指向文本字段)属性。

+0

谢谢。问题解决了 :) – Mohsan 2010-01-11 09:19:48

0

comboBox1.SelectedValue这种情况; comboBox1.SelectedText;

这两个将为你工作。

快乐编码。

+0

但这将用于获取值和文本。我的问题是如何保存这些(文字,值) – Mohsan 2010-01-11 08:59:53